How does drop-in daycare work
- To take advantage of drop-in daycare services, it's important to first complete the registration process for your child. Once enrolled, you gain the flexibility to use the daycare on an as-needed basis. However, it's advisable to check availability in advance—either by calling or booking online—to secure your spot. This type of daycare is especially beneficial for parents in need of occasional childcare solutions or when unexpected gaps in regular childcare arise.

What is a drop-in daycare?
- A drop-in daycare is a program where parents can drop their children off for a few hours per day or when their regular care isn't available. Some programs may offer full-day drop-in care while others only provide a few hours of care at a time.
